Output 347315f60bbfd0333a04c6b11a103bee6b5c5dc080ea8daa0aca0b41d7422bdf:0

value
21060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 178eeb06f2d59516d32b199cccc317180d44dcca OP_EQUAL
address
33qag5TtdJg9bhRq4XhBNxtcMoWkL8Ghzw
transaction
347315f60bbfd0333a04c6b11a103bee6b5c5dc080ea8daa0aca0b41d7422bdf
confirmations
181829
spent
true